Press Passes for Freelance Journalists & Creators: What you need to know
It’s a new day for new media in the White House. Freelance journalists and content creators of all sorts can now apply for White House press passes to get access to the White House briefing room.
Press secretary Karoline Leavitt said the Trump administration is making it a priority to communicate with “new media” and creators of all sorts will have access.
